    I used to think the exact same way too, but the truck pull works excellent. I use 3/4" Stable braid x 200 ft. I redirect with a 3 ton stainless block and 3/4" sling. Setup is quick. Several times I had pulled a tree in a back yard with the truck in the front yard with 3 pulley-block redirects...
